PowerUP
A foundation started by Gateway and AOL, launching from the Silicon Valley
and receiving hundreds of applications daily from all over the country,
PowerUP made N2R two site affiliates. As soon as the FYBR pilot is finished
it will be distributed nationally in 284 PowerUP sites throughout the
nation. PowerUp is about to expand this program to four international
locations.
Gateway
Generously donated 12 Pentium 3 computers to be used as a state of the art
Internet lab for at-risk children to learn job and life skills through the
FYBR telementoring program.
